Synchronizing ESP
If the power supply was interrupted (battery discon-
nected or discharged), the BAS/ESP malfunction indica-
tor light may be illuminated with the engine running. To
re-synchronize the ESP, and cancel the malfunction indi-
cator light, the steering angle sensor will need to be
recalibrated.1. Turn the ignition switch to the ON/RUN position.
2. Rotate the steering wheel to the center position.
3. Rotate the steering wheel completely to the left, and
then rotate the steering wheel completely to the right.
4. Bring the steering wheel back to the center position.
5. The BAS/ESP malfunction indicator light will go out.
If the BAS/ESP malfunction indicator light is still illumi-
nated, the vehicle should be serviced at an authorized
dealer.

5. Fuel Gauge
When the ignition is in the ON/RUN position, the
pointer will show the level of fuel remaining in the tank.
The arrow to the right of the gas pump symbol shows
which side of the vehicle the fuel filler door is located on.
6. Turn Signal Indicators
To signal minor directional changes, such as
changing lanes, move the multifunction con-
trol lever to the point of resistance only and
hold it there. The arrows will flash in unison
with the corresponding exterior turn signal.
To operate the turn signals continuously, move the mul-
tifunction control lever past the point of resistance up or
down. The switch is automatically canceled when the
steering wheel is turned to a large enough degree.The arrows in the instrument cluster will flash in unison
with the respective exterior turn signal.
7. Electronic Stability Program (ESP) Indicator
Light
The yellow ESP indicator light in the speedom-
eter dial comes on with the key in the ignition
switch turned to the ON/RUN position. It
should go out with the engine running.
If the ESP indicator light flashes during acceleration,
apply as little throttle as possible. While driving, ease up
on the accelerator. Adapt your speed and driving to the
prevailing road conditions, and do not switch off the ESP.
8. Speedometer
The speedometer shows the vehicle speed in miles-per-
hour and/or kilometers-per-hour.
9. Tachometer
This gauge shows engine speed in revolutions-per-
minute (RPM) times 1,000.
The red markings on the tachometer indicate excessive
engine speed. Ease off on the accelerator before reaching
the red area.

24. Airbag Light
The operational readiness of the airbag sys-
tem is verified by the airbag indicator light
in the instrument cluster when turning the
key in the ignition switch to the ACC or
ON/RUN position. If no fault is detected, the light
will go out after approximately 4 seconds. After the
lamp goes out, the system continues to monitor the
components and circuitry of the airbag system and
will indicate a malfunction by coming on again.
The light will come on and remain on for 4 seconds as a
bulb check when the ignition switch is first turned ON. Ifthe bulb is not lit during starting, have it replaced. If the
light stays on, or comes on while driving, have the
system checked by an authorized dealer.
WARNING!
In the event a malfunction of the airbag is indicated,
the airbag may not be operational. For your safety,
we strongly recommend that you visit an authorized
dealer immediately to have the system checked;
otherwise the airbag may not be activated when
needed in an accident, which could result in serious
or fatal injury, or it might deploy unexpectedly and
unnecessarily which could also result in injury.

Anti-Lock Brake System (ABS)
The ABS gives increased vehicle stability and brake
performance under most braking conditions. The system
automatically “pumps” the brakes during severe braking
conditions to prevent wheel lock-up. The system operates
to prevent wheel lock-up and help avoid skidding on
slippery surfaces.
NOTE:The ABS improves steering control of the ve-
hicle during hard braking maneuvers.
The ABS prevents the wheels from locking up above a
vehicle speed of approximately 5 mph (8 km/h)
independent of road surface conditions.
At the instant one of the wheels is about to lock up, a
slight pulsation can be felt in the brake pedal, indicat-
ing that the ABS is in the regulating mode.
Keep firm and steady pressure on the brake pedal
while experiencing the pulsation. Continuous, steady
brake pedal pressure results in optimal braking power
while maintaining the ability to steer the vehicle.In the case of an emergency brake maneuver, keep
continuous full pressure on the brake pedal. In this
manner only can the ABS be most effective.
On slippery road surfaces, the ABS will respond even
with light brake pedal pressure because of the in-
creased likelihood of locking wheels. The pulsating
brake pedal can be an indication of hazardous road
conditions and functions as a reminder to take extra
care while driving.WARNING!
Significant over- or under-inflation of tires, or mix-
ing sizes of front or rear tires or wheels on the
vehicle can reduce braking effectiveness. Maintain
proper tire pressure and always use the tires and
wheels specified in this manual for your vehicle.

Brake Pad Break-In
The brakes on your vehicle do not require a long break-in
period, but avoid repeated hard brake applications from
high speeds during initial break-in. Also avoid severe
brake loading such as may be encountered when de-
scending long mountain grades.
POWER STEERING
The standard power steering system will give you good
vehicle response and increased ease of maneuverability
in tight spaces. The system will provide mechanical
steering capability if power assist is lost.
If for some reason, the power assist is interrupted, it will
still be possible to steer your vehicle. Under these condi-
tions you will observe a substantial increase in steering
effort, especially at very low vehicle speeds and during
parking maneuvers.
NOTE:Increased noise levels at the end of the steering
wheel travel are considered normal and does not indicate
that there is a problem with the power steering system.
Upon initial start-up in cold weather, the power
steering pump may make noise for a short period of
time. This is due to the cold, thick fluid in the steering
system. This noise should be considered normal, and
does not in any way damage the steering system.
WARNING!
Continued operation with reduced power steering
assist could pose a safety risk to yourself and others.
Service should be obtained as soon as possible.
CAUTION!
Prolong operation of the steering system at the end
of the steering wheel travel will increase the steering
fluid temperature and should be avoided when
possible. Damage to the power steering pump may
occur.

If you need snow tires, the recommended size for the
front and rear tires is the same size as the original
equipment front tires. This size tire on the rear allows the
use of tire chains on the rear wheels. Selection of this size
tire also requires the purchase of two additional wheels
with the same size specification as the original equip-
ment front wheels.
Snow tires may have a lower speed rating than factory
equipped tires and may not match the maximum vehicle
speed.
Snow tires should not be operated at sustained speeds
over 75 mph (120 km/h).TIRE ROTATION RECOMMENDATIONS
Tires on the front and rear axles of vehicles operate at
different loads and perform different steering, driving,
and braking functions. For these reasons, they wear at
unequal rates, and tend to develop irregular wear pat-
terns.
These effects can be reduced by timely rotation of tires.
The benefits of rotation are especially worthwhile with
aggressive tread designs such as those on all season type
tires. Rotation will increase tread life, help to maintain
mud, snow, and wet traction levels, and contribute to a
smooth, quiet ride.
